After all the pre viewing hype I found this mini series to be not as good as I had hoped for.The story line was confusing and the acting left something to be desired.Lisa McCune in her first major role tried hard to be the heroine but she did not fit the part as a London cockney and her accent was false.However for an Aussie production it was quite good viewing and such series should be encouraged.
